Humboldt: Where Majestic Redwoods Embrace the Spirit of Adventure

Nestled in the heart of West Tennessee, Humboldt is a charming small town that offers a delightful blend of Southern hospitality and rich cultural heritage. Famous for its vibrant music scene, particularly the annual Humboldt Strawberry Festival, visitors can immerse themselves in local traditions, arts, and crafts. Explore the surrounding natural beauty at nearby parks, or take a leisurely stroll through the historic downtown filled with unique shops and eateries. With its inviting atmosphere and community spirit, Humboldt is a hidden gem perfect for travelers seeking an authentic slice of Tennessee life. Best time to go to Humboldt

Humboldt exper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 38.5°F (3.6°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 79.7°F (26.5°C). April is usually the wettest month. April to June are the peak travel months in Humboldt,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with light rainfall. On the other hand, February, October, and November t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
